So far, so professional. If a married couple's income is under $32,000 ($25,000 with regard to the single taxpayer), Social Security benefits are not taxable. If combined wages are between $32,000 and $44,000 (or $25,000 and $34,000 for a specific person), the taxable amount Social Security equals lower of half of Social Security benefits or half of desire between combined income and $32,000 ($25,000 if single).
